Cato Institute Seminar

 

The BEPS Project:
The OECD, Tax Policy, and U.S. Competitiveness


B-338 Rayburn House Office Building

Friday, July 17th, at 12PM
Lunch Included

Dominated by Europe’s welfare states, the Paris-based Organization for Economic Cooperation and Development (OECD) has been pushing policies to enable higher taxes and bigger government. The latest example is a base erosion and profit-shifting (BEPS) initiative that would raise business tax burdens and undermine the competitiveness of American firms operating in global markets. An expert panel will explain the new OECD scheme and outline a better policy approach.
